This week, our staff had the incredible opportunity to learn from Graciela Ángeles Carreño and Ximena Ángeles of Real Minero, and Miriam Pacheco of Uruapan Charanda.
Real Minero is a leader in traditional mezcal, carrying forward the clay-pot distilling heritage of Santa Catarina Minas, producing agave spirits of remarkable texture, depth, and sense of place.
Uruapan Charanda represents Michoacán’s protected charanda tradition, a sugarcane spirit shaped by local raw materials, volcanic red soils, and more than a century of Pacheco family history.
